When DIY Wedding Planning Shines
- For couples who love a hands-on approach and enjoy personalizing every detail, DIY wedding planning can be rewarding. Here’s when it’s the right choice:
- For Small, Intimate Weddings
DIY planning works well for weddings with fewer than 50 guests. A smaller scale means fewer logistics, making it easier to manage the details yourself. - If You’re Organized and Creative
Thriving on checklists and Pinterest boards? If spreadsheets and timelines excite you more than stress you out, DIY planning might be a perfect fit. - With Supportive Friends and Family
Having loved ones who are ready to help with tasks like venue setup or décor can lighten the load. Just make sure they’re up for the challenge—being a helping hand might mean missing out on some of the fun. - When You’re Budget-Conscious
DIY planning can help save on costs, especially for elements like decorations, invitations, and favors. However, it’s essential to plan carefully to avoid overspending or last-minute surprises. - If You’re Flexible About Results
DIY weddings often have a “perfectly imperfect” charm. If you can embrace minor hiccups, you’ll likely enjoy the process.
When Hiring a Wedding Planner Is Essential
- You’re Planning a Large, Multi-Layered Event
Big weddings with extensive guest lists, multiple vendors, and elaborate timelines require professional coordination. A wedding planner brings the expertise to ensure everything runs like clockwork. - Your Schedule Is Already Packed
Let’s face it—wedding planning is time-intensive. If your life is already busy with work, family, or other commitments, a planner can take on the heavy lifting, giving you space to focus on what matters. - You Want a Worry-Free Experience
Stressing about delivery delays, last-minute cancellations, or vendor mix-ups is no way to spend your wedding day. A planner handles these challenges behind the scenes so you can stay in the moment. - You’re Planning a Destination Wedding
Destination weddings come with unique hurdles, from coordinating long-distance logistics to understanding local customs. A professional planner with destination experience ensures your vision comes to life, even from miles away. - You Have a Bold, Unique Vision
Complex designs and ambitious themes require a professional touch. A planner’s expertise ensures your ideas are executed beautifully and within budget.
The Middle Ground: Partial Planning or Day-Of Coordination
What if you want the best of both worlds? Many couples choose partial planning or day-of coordination to bridge the gap between DIY and full-service planning. This option allows you to take charge of the creative aspects while a professional handles logistics and ensures the day runs smoothly.

Deciding Between DIY and Hiring a Planner
To determine the best route for your wedding, ask yourself these questions:
- Do we have the time and energy to plan every detail?
- Are we comfortable troubleshooting issues on the wedding day?
- Is our wedding simple or more elaborate?
- Do we want to enjoy the process—or focus solely on the experience?
